The Promise of Ethereum for Global Transactions
Ethereum’s core strength lies in its blockchain technology, which offers several advantages over traditional systems:
- Decentralization: No single entity controls the network, reducing the risk of censorship and single points of failure.
- Transparency: All transactions are recorded on a public ledger, promoting accountability and trust.
- Smart Contracts: Automated agreements that execute when predefined conditions are met, streamlining processes and reducing the need for intermediaries.
- Speed and Efficiency: Potentially faster and cheaper transactions compared to traditional banking systems, especially for cross-border payments.
These features make Ethereum an attractive platform for a variety of global applications, including:
- Cross-border payments and remittances
- Supply chain management
- International trade finance
- Decentralized finance (DeFi) applications for global investors
Challenges to Adoption
Despite its potential, Ethereum faces several challenges that need to be addressed before it can become a truly global transaction platform:
Scalability Issues
Ethereum’s current transaction throughput is limited, leading to congestion and high gas fees, particularly during periods of high demand; Solutions like Layer-2 scaling solutions (e.g., rollups) are being developed to address this, but their widespread adoption and effectiveness remain to be seen.
Regulatory Uncertainty
The regulatory landscape surrounding cryptocurrencies and blockchain technology is still evolving, and varies significantly across different jurisdictions. This uncertainty can hinder the adoption of Ethereum for global transactions, as businesses and individuals may be hesitant to use a platform that is subject to unclear or conflicting regulations;
Security Concerns
While Ethereum itself is generally secure, smart contracts are vulnerable to bugs and exploits, which can lead to significant financial losses. Rigorous auditing and testing are essential to mitigate these risks.
Interoperability
Seamless integration with existing financial systems and other blockchain networks is crucial for Ethereum to become a truly global platform. Efforts are underway to improve interoperability, but further progress is needed.
FAQ: Ethereum and Global Transactions
Here are some frequently asked questions about using Ethereum for global transactions:
- Q: Will Ethereum replace traditional banking systems?
A: It’s unlikely that Ethereum will completely replace traditional banking systems in the near future. However, it has the potential to disrupt certain aspects of the financial industry and offer alternative solutions for specific use cases. - Q: How can I use Ethereum for cross-border payments?
A: You can use cryptocurrency exchanges or decentralized applications (dApps) that support cross-border payments using Ethereum. However, it’s important to research and understand the risks involved before using any platform. - Q: What are the gas fees on Ethereum?
A: Gas fees are the transaction fees required to execute operations on the Ethereum network. They fluctuate based on network congestion and the complexity of the transaction.
- Q: Is Ethereum environmentally friendly?
A: Ethereum has transitioned to a Proof-of-Stake (PoS) consensus mechanism, which significantly reduces its energy consumption compared to the previous Proof-of-Work (PoW) system.
